Christian Eriksen’s first words from the hospital: “I want to understand what happened to me”

The player was in a good mood, but wants to understand what happened. Photo: REUTERS / Friedemann

These are hours of relief and calm for the Danish footballer Christian Eriksen, after the fainting that he suffered last Saturday in the match that his team played against Finland for the European Championship. The images of the midfielder’s collapse and the actions of the doctors performing cardiopulmonary resuscitation (CPR) shocked the world, but they are now part of the past. By now, the Inter player is in a good mood and has been able to talk to his teammates.

This was confirmed Martin Schoots, agent of the steering wheel of the Inter, who gave some details of the conversations that the Milan player had in the last hours. “I want to understand what happened to me”, was one of the things that the 29-year-old soccer player said to his loved ones in the framework of his admission to a hospital in Copenhagen. Also, jokingly during a chat with his teammates, he added: “I’m ready to go back to training!”

As published by the Italian media The Gazzetta dello Sport, the Danish agent revealed the dialogue he had with the figure who is excited to return to the courts: “He joked, because he was in a good mood. I found him fine, but we all want to understand what happened to him, he wants to do it too. That is why doctors are conducting in-depth examinations. It will take time”.

“I was happy, because understood how much love is around. Messages have reached him from all over the world. And he was particularly impressed by how everyone at Inter reacted. Not only the teammates he heard through the chat, but also the fans. Christian won’t give up. Him and his family they want to thank everyone for the support they received”, Continued shot.

Eriksen He remains stable, but will continue to be admitted to the clinic where he will receive the required medical attention. His colleagues, family and friends had the opportunity to visit him and in one of those meetings the figure of Denmark He was smiling and grateful towards Simon Kjær, captain of the Scandinavian national team, who contained the couple at the wheel at the moment of greatest tension that was observed in the match against Finland. “A lot of people worried about Chris. Now he just has to rest with his inner circle ”, explained his representative.

After the messages he received from his former coaches, teammates, sponsors and some former executives, the footballer is with his wife and parents. According to his agent, the player He will remain under observation and is expected to leave the hospital on Tuesday.He wants to be with his team again to support the team in the next game against Belgium. “, he detailed.

For the reassurance of his fans and supporters, the mood of Eriksen is so optimistic that he even dared to make some jokes in the dialogue he had with Lukaku through a video call. “I think you’re in worse shape than me! Now I would be ready to train”, The Dane said with humor to the Belgian striker with whom he shares the squad of the Nerazzurro.

The Inter Milan player fell collapsed during the 43rd minute of the game cheered by Denmark and Finland at the Parken Stadion. The midfielder suffered a cardiorespiratory arrest and was treated on the lawn by the stadium toilets, who tried to revive him for almost 15 minutes. Finally, was stabilized and transferred to a hospital, where it remains stable and conscious.

During the last days, the footballing planet expressed its support accompanied by the desire for a speedy recovery. In the last hours, the Swedish squad was another of the teams that gave him a clear message before his debut in the Eurocup against Spain.

The Swedish coach, Jane Andersson, and his captain Sebastian Larsson, showed this Sunday their “support” for the Danish through a photo in which the entire squad could be seen gathered next to a flag that said “Lucha Christian”.

“The news has reached us that he is quite well and we will play our game tomorrow. Hopefully this is the only event of this type in the tournament ”, said the Scandinavian coach, while the midfielder said that “you don’t think of countries or rivalries when something like this happens, we think of another human being, a colleague and I want to send my support to Eriksen, his family and his teammates. Hopefully we can see him soon ”.
